How can I redirect another page after login in Laravel?
“how to redirect to another page after login in laravel” Code Answer's
- protected function authenticated(Request $request, $user) {
- if ($user->role_id == 1) {
- return redirect('/admin');
- } else if ($user->role_id == 2) {
- return redirect('/author');
- } else {
- return redirect('/blog');
- }

Where should we redirect the request after authorization Laravel?
Laravel Auth features a function to redirect logged-in user to the same page they were visiting before. So, for example, if you visit /posts, you get automatically redirected to /login and then enter your data successfully, Laravel will “remember” and redirect you back to /posts instead of default /home.
